It's actually believed to be Denver. The script never specifies, but the author Mary Chase was from Denver and she says that the play takes place "In a city in the West".

Politically, Stewart was a staunch supporter of the Republican Party and actively campaigned for Richard Nixon and Ronald Reagan.One of his best friends was Henry Fonda, despite the fact that the two men had very different political ideologies. A political argument in 1947 resulted in a fist fight between them, but the two apparently maintained their friendship by never discussing politics again. There is brief reference to their political differences in their movie The Cheyenne Social Club.
